### Government Vaccination Programs

Government initiatives aimed at increasing vaccination rates are likely to bolster the tetanus toxoid-vaccine market. Programs such as the Vaccines for Children (VFC) program provide free vaccines to eligible children, which may include the tetanus toxoid vaccine. This initiative is crucial in ensuring that underserved populations receive necessary immunizations. Furthermore, state and local health departments often conduct outreach programs to educate communities about the importance of vaccinations, including tetanus toxoid. As these programs expand, the tetanus toxoid-vaccine market may experience increased demand, particularly among low-income families who may otherwise forgo vaccinations due to cost concerns. The financial support from government programs could lead to a more robust market presence.
